今天给各位分享wireshark抓包手机的知识,其中也会对wireshark抓包软件进行解释 ,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
1 、为了在电脑上抓取手机的数据包,首先需要准备一台运行Windows操作系统的电脑和一部支持热点功能的安卓手机。接下来 ,我们需要在电脑上创建一个热点,这可以通过运行cmd命令来实现 。
2、打开iPhone的设置,进入“无线局域网”。找到名为“Connectify-me”的无线网络 ,点击并输入密码进行连接。测试连接:连接成功后,在iPhone上打开浏览器尝试打开一个网页,确认连接是否成功。使用Wireshark抓包 运行Wireshark:打开Wireshark软件 ,点击“Interface List ”查看哪张网卡正在发送和接收数据包 。
3、sudo chown linbing:admin bp*验证权限:ls -la | grep bp 启动Wireshark并抓包步骤:重新执行rvictl命令(确保接口已创建)。打开Wireshark,选择对应的虚拟接口(如rvi0)。开始捕获数据包 。 停止抓包并清理停止捕获:在Wireshark中点击红色停止按钮。
4 、启动Wireshark软件在电脑中打开Wireshark应用程序,界面如下:选择网络接口点击顶部工具栏的抓取网络接口卡选择按钮(图标为两个电脑屏幕) ,弹出接口列表窗口。根据数据流量判断目标接口:选择Packets项数据变化最多的接口(通常为活跃的网卡,如以太网或Wi-Fi接口) 。
使用Fiddler软件在WiFi环境下对安卓App进行抓包,具体操作步骤如下:工具准备需准备一台安卓手机和安装Fiddler软件的电脑 ,确保两者连接至同一WiFi网络。Fiddler基础设置 启动Fiddler,点击菜单栏“工具→Fiddler选项”打开设置对话框。
使用Fiddler进行安卓端抓包:首先,下载并安装Fiddler抓包软件 。接着,配置Fiddler ,包括设置HTTPS解密和Connections等参数,以确保能够捕获HTTPS流量。确保手机与电脑连接的是同一个Wi-Fi网络,并在手机端设置代理为手动 ,输入电脑的IP地址和Fiddler配置的端口号。
重启Charles或手机网络连接,排除临时故障 。检查防火墙或安全软件是否阻止Charles的网络访问。使用后关闭代理 抓包完成后,及时关闭Charles代理功能(Proxy → Stop Recording) ,避免隐私泄露或数据安全风险。处理敏感信息时,建议清除Charles抓取的历史数据(File → Clear Session)。
部分安卓版本(如Android 11及以上)需额外操作:在证书安装界面勾选“用于VPN和应用”,或通过ADB命令将证书安装至系统分区(需解锁Bootloader) 。验证抓包效果 重启Charles软件 ,确保其处于运行状态。在手机上打开任意应用或浏览器访问网页,观察Charles界面是否显示网络请求。
安装抓包工具 打开应用中心:在手机上找到并打开应用中心(或应用商店) 。搜索抓包工具:在搜索框中输入“抓包精灵 ”或其他类似的抓包软件名称进行搜索。下载并安装:找到目标软件后,点击下载并安装到手机上。安装完成后 ,手机屏幕上会出现抓包精灵的图标 。
首先,通过命令行的tcpdump抓取包并保存为pcap格式,然后在本地电脑上通过Wireshark筛选出目标APP的数据包。然而,TCP数据包内容通常是私有协议或加密 ,大部分是乱码,难以直接解析。通过观察包中的少许可见字符,比如“b”和“s” ,可以作为线索 。通过反编译APK,利用搜索功能找到与这些字符相关的代码。
搞定某APP的TCP抓包,并直接调用so文件进行Hook抓取的方法如下:使用tcpdump抓取TCP数据包:在手机上通过命令行使用tcpdump工具抓取TCP数据包 ,并将其保存为pcap格式。将pcap文件传输到本地电脑上,使用Wireshark进行数据包筛选和分析 。
定制frida脚本:如果APP使用了自定义的SSL发包方式,可以通过逆向分析找到相关的函数 ,并定制Frida脚本进行抓包。搜索ssl_read,ssl_write函数:如果APP的核心逻辑所在的so文件中没有ssl_read,ssl_write函数 ,可以使用记事本等工具搜索整个应用目录文件,找到可能调用的其他so文件,并定制Frida脚本进行抓包。
步骤一:加载并查找关键函数 首先,在IDA中加载libsscronet.so库 ,等待加载完成。利用关键字“SSL_CTX_set_custom_verify ”定位到相关函数 。在该函数中,找到执行证书校验的`sub_110FDC`函数。步骤二:修改证书校验 深入`sub_110FDC`函数,关注第三个参数 ,它是一个回调函数,用于校验证书。
r0capture专注于全协议覆盖,通过动态注入脚本拦截应用层网络调用 ,实现无差别抓包 。实现原理:挂钩(Hook)关键网络API(如socket、send、recv),拦截数据包并解析协议头。对SSL/TLS流量,直接提取加密前/后的明文或密文(取决于挂钩深度)。
此时 ,应用将不再使用TCP长连接,转而通过HTTP方式与服务器通信,从而实现数据抓取 。验证抓包过程 ,确保Charles能够成功捕获所有HTTP请求及其响应,以确保抓包策略的有效性。通过上述方法,借助Charles与Postern的结合,可以高效地实现对移动长连接环境下App包的抓包 ,为开发者和测试人员提供了有力的工具支持。
1 、在CTF竞赛中,Wireshark常被用于流量数据分析,能快速识别网络通信数据 ,提供详尽的网络封包资料 。Wireshark利用WinPCAP接口直接与网卡交换数据,用户可在图形界面实时监控TCP、会话等网络动态,高效完成网络管理。
2、使用Wireshark抓取P2P直播源的步骤如下:准备工具与原料需安装Wireshark网络抓包工具 ,并准备一个支持P2P协议的直播软件。启动直播软件打开P2P直播软件并播放目标电视台,确保视频流处于传输状态 。配置Wireshark抓包启动Wireshark,选择当前设备正在使用的网卡(如以太网或Wi-Fi) ,开始捕获网络数据包。
3 、使用Wireshark工具抓取直播。打开wireshark抓包工具。打开要抓取直播的客户端 。在wireshark抓包工具中点击startcapture开始抓包。当开wireshark工具开始抓包时,立即进入直播间。在直播间内停留2-3秒后即可抓包成功 。
4、想要通过Fiddler进行抓包,需要分析apk ,去掉相关校验代码,或者通过网卡抓包的方式(如Wireshark、tcpdump)进行。Wireshark解密HTTPS Wireshark是一款强大的网络协议分析工具,能够捕获并详细显示网络数据包。然而,HTTPS数据包是加密的 ,需要额外配置才能解密 。
1 、手机抓包工具推荐使用Wireshark和Fiddler。详细解释: Wireshark:Wireshark是一款非常流行的网络协议分析工具,它支持多种操作系统,包括手机操作系统。通过Wireshark ,用户可以捕获并分析网络中传输的数据包,这对于网络调试、故障排除和安全审计非常有用 。
2、简介:Reqable是一款功能强大的抓包工具,特别适用于Flutter移动应用的抓包调试。它提供了直观的操作界面和丰富的功能 ,帮助开发者快速定位和解决网络问题。 HTTP Debugger v9中文特别版 简介:HTTP Debugger是一款中文特别版的抓包工具,支持对HTTP协议的数据包进行捕获和分析 。
3、经验总结与工具选择建议Thor 抓包:适合轻量级需求,安装即用 ,适合快速验证。复杂调试:依赖桌面工具,Charles 、Fiddler、mitmproxy 更强大。协议层分析:必备 Wireshark,能看见握手细节、TCP 流量。高安全场景:依赖 Sniffmaster ,绕过 SSL Pinning,是 iOS 真机抓包的最终解法 。
4 、经过一番搜索,我发现了一些手机端封包软件,它们能够帮助玩家轻松实现抓包、发送等功能。比如“抓包大师 ” ,它不仅支持多种游戏协议,还提供了直观的操作界面,用户可以轻松上手。此外 ,“封包专家”同样是一款不错的选择,它支持自动保存抓包数据,并提供了详细的参数设置选项 ,方便玩家进行调试 。
5、Thor Thor(锤子)是一款功能强大的抓包App,以其出色的过滤器和自定义规则功能而著称。这款工具的售价为68美元,虽然价格相对较高 ,但其强大的功能使其成为许多专业用户的首选。强大的过滤器功能:Thor允许用户自定义开发过滤规则,这在进行复杂网络调试时尤为重要 。